2008-10-31 101 views
1

您有推薦用於網站架構設計和分析的任何工具嗎?我已經檢查了Poseidon UML,Adalon和FuseBuilder for ColdFusion,Mindmapper和其他一些軟件,但還沒有找到任何似乎在允許快速高層次規劃(如可以用心靈映射)到更詳細的體系結構和分析。 UML似乎是應用程序設計的終極目標,但我不認爲像Poseidon UML這樣的工具在創建快速初始設計時特別適用。還有什麼可以應用於任何編程語言,從CF到C#。也許是工具的組合?適用於網站架構設計的最佳工具

回答

1

我的幻想建模工具將

  • 成爲「智能主板」啓用
    • 記錄白板
    • 充當任何軟件是它的背後,讓繪圖/突出一個「指針設備」
    • OCR
  • 記錄故事,很容易三五牌
  • 允許使用案例穿行用故事板UI屏幕(起初只是命名頁)
  • 支持快速&髒級或E/R圖表
  • 出口到進口的中性格式,以更正式的建模工具。

不幸的是,我買不起硬件,我不認爲軟件是以無縫方式存在的。

所以

我用的白板,數碼相機,「粘貼便條,錄音,手提電腦與分析或故事的錄製工作。

我用海神缺乏更好的[經濟實惠]工具

Wiki是用於發佈文件/內容,用戶/客戶可以查看和評論有用。

我也用的Visio當別人在爲它付出代價。

我迫不及待地想看到這篇文章的其他回覆,希望找到一些更好的答案!

+0

我同意,這將是一個很棒的設置。更重要的是,我只希望能夠以一種映射格式快速記下想法和使用案例,這些格式稍後可以輕鬆完成並可能移植到UML中。 – 2008-10-31 22:46:46

1

我不用C語言編碼,但爲了我的錢,我喜歡Visio

+0

我依稀記得幾年前和Visio一起玩過,它確實是一個相當不錯的產品。從我記憶中,我唯一的抱怨是,當它涉及到高層次的規劃時,它似乎有點笨重和過度參與。 – 2008-10-31 22:44:31

0

安妮,截至目前,我通常使用Visio,儘管這對於快速簡單的事情來說並不是一個很好的工具,因爲大部分時間都是很痛苦的。

我不知道您是否感興趣,但Visual Studio 2010即將推出預覽版,該預覽版應該包含一些可幫助在同一工具中構建用戶故事,UML圖等的「奧斯陸」位,並允許您以有趣的方式將多個想法映射到一起。

我已經從PDC 2008 docs/casts中讀到了關於使用他們的新域語言「M」來定義您的域的模型並允許您構建SQL以支持您的模型等等。至少從我看來,可以告訴一個完整的架構設置工具集。看起來你真的不需要使用.NET來利用它,它只是可以生成的代碼不會對你有很大的好處,如果它不適合.NET,但是使用案例圖,活動圖,用戶故事,流程圖,流程圖,各個方面對於任何項目都仍然非常有用。 「M」DSL還可以幫助您建模實體並從一個工具中獲取SQL。

正如我剛纔所說,我不知道這些信息對你有多大用處,原因有幾個。 1)它還沒有出現,2)它是一個Visual Studio的東西(據我所知),3)它的一些優點在.NET Framework中完全實現。即使你不使用.NET,這個東西的預覽應該很快就會出來(應該是免費的),但仍然有很多事情可以做。不幸的是,這對你現在沒有任何好處。但是如果你和我一樣,你會不斷地看到將要發生的事情,看看它會如何影響你今天的行爲以及明天你會做什麼。所以至少在這方面有用:)。

+0

這聽起來非常有希望,並且增加SQL支持的功能將是一個夢想。我一定會留意這個版本。 – 2008-10-31 22:49:19

0

魔術畫很不錯。你也可以看看sybase UML解決方案。

說到未來,你可以看看the modeling possibilities in VS2010。但是,這只是前置Alpha狀態。您還應該跟進奧斯陸,M和象限發生的事情......

0

您可能有興趣使用ForeUI,它是一個創建網站/軟件架構模型的工具。